Europe and Eurasia Development and Public/Private Alliances: The Bureau for Europe and Eurasia (E&E) of the United States Agency for International Development (USAID) invites interest from prospective partner organizations to form public-private alliances to carry out activities in support of the E&E Bureau?s international development objectives. Throughout this document, references to alliance partners refer to partners which may constitute one or more entities or individuals. Alliance partners are expected to bring significant new resources, ideas, technologies, and/or partners to address development problems in countries where the E&E Bureau is currently working. Partners could include a wide range of organizations, examples of which are discussed below. Successful applications will bring at least a 1:1 resource matching to focus on priority development activities within the Bureau?s strategic interests.
